Taking Photographs
P, S, A, and M Modes
P, S, A, and M modes give you varying degrees of control
over shutter speed and aperture.
Mode P: Program AE
Let the camera choose shutter speed and aperture for optimal
exposure. Other values that produce the same exposure can be
selected with program shift.
The camera functions in mode P (program AE) when the shutter
speed dial is rotated to A or P. Aperture is set as follows.

Lenses with aperture rings: Mode P can be selected by
rotating the ring to A (auto).
Lenses without aperture rings: Mode P can be selected
by pressing the center of the front command dial to
cycle to APERTURE and then rotating the dial to
choose A (auto).
